Output 6590691abaf2f3c60c64b77c241c42f132a9e8b1e7ac1fb9b49f244548f4f96a:1

value
459107391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c35315479fff6e1cc8227aff8843dcb85233161d OP_EQUALVERIFY OP_CHECKSIG
address
Ld2jZLUd8EbJyhwyMEqv7iezYaoNKT8HAi
transaction
6590691abaf2f3c60c64b77c241c42f132a9e8b1e7ac1fb9b49f244548f4f96a
spent
true